Hạ tầng điều phối thông báo thông minh

Notiboost tự động kiểm tra trạng thái hoạt động của khách hàng trên Zalo trước khi quyết định kênh gửi tin hiệu quả nhất. Một API duy nhất, điều khiển tất cả kênh.

🏢
Hệ thống khách hàng
Gửi event qua API
🔌
Notiboost API
Nhận và xử lý event
🧠
Smart Routing Logic
Kiểm tra trạng thái & chọn kênh
Zalo ZNS Email SMS Push
Kênh thông báo
Gửi và theo dõi delivery

Không bao giờ gián đoạn, luôn luôn tối ưu

3 tính năng cốt lõi đảm bảo tin nhắn luôn đến đích với chi phí thấp nhất

🎯

Priority Routing

Tự động ưu tiên kênh có chi phí thấp nhất (Push → Zalo → SMS) dựa trên trạng thái người dùng và giá cả từng kênh. Giảm chi phí tối đa mà vẫn đảm bảo trải nghiệm tốt nhất.

Routing Logic: Push (0đ) → Zalo ZNS (250đ) → SMS (800đ)
🔄

Auto-Failover

Tự động chuyển sang kênh dự phòng nếu kênh chính gặp lỗi hoặc không có phản hồi trong thời gian quy định. Đảm bảo 100% tỷ lệ nhận tin, không bao giờ mất liên lạc với khách hàng.

Timeout Settings: 30s cho Zalo, 60s cho Push, configurable

Latency Control

Đảm bảo tin nhắn quan trọng (OTP, xác nhận thanh toán) được xử lý trong thời gian ngắn nhất. Tự động bỏ qua các kênh chậm và chuyển sang kênh nhanh hơn.

Performance Targets: < 2s cho OTP, < 5s cho thông báo thường
🔑 BYOK - Bring Your Own Key

Tự do kết nối nhà cung cấp của bạn

Khả năng tích hợp linh hoạt với bất kỳ nhà cung cấp nào. Khách hàng có thể kết nối API của Zalo Cloud, eSMS, FPT, VietGuys hoặc bất kỳ vendor nào khác.

Bạn giữ giá sỉ của nhà mạng, chúng tôi cung cấp công nghệ điều phối.

💰
Tiết kiệm thêm 20-30% So với dùng hạ tầng mặc định
🔒
Kiểm soát hoàn toàn Dùng vendor riêng của bạn
📡
Hỗ trợ đa vendor Zalo, eSMS, FPT, VietGuys...

Developer Experience - Tích hợp trong 5 phút

Một API call duy nhất, Notiboost xử lý tất cả logic điều phối. Không cần hard-code, không cần deploy lại khi thay đổi workflow.

// Một API call duy nhất
const response = await notiboost.trigger(
  'order_success',
  'user_123',
  {
    order_id: 'ORD-001',
    amount: 500000,
    items: ['Product A', 'Product B']
  }
);

// Notiboost tự động:
// 1. Kiểm tra trạng thái user
// 2. Chọn kênh tối ưu (Push → Zalo → SMS)
// 3. Gửi và theo dõi delivery
// 4. Failover nếu cần
// Một API call duy nhất
$response = $notiboost->trigger(
  'order_success',
  'user_123',
  [
    'order_id' => 'ORD-001',
    'amount' => 500000,
    'items' => ['Product A', 'Product B']
  ]
);

// Notiboost tự động:
// 1. Kiểm tra trạng thái user
// 2. Chọn kênh tối ưu (Push → Zalo → SMS)
// 3. Gửi và theo dõi delivery
// 4. Failover nếu cần
# Một API call duy nhất
response = notiboost.trigger(
  'order_success',
  'user_123',
  {
    'order_id': 'ORD-001',
    'amount': 500000,
    'items': ['Product A', 'Product B']
  }
)

# Notiboost tự động:
# 1. Kiểm tra trạng thái user
# 2. Chọn kênh tối ưu (Push → Zalo → SMS)
# 3. Gửi và theo dõi delivery
# 4. Failover nếu cần
🔗

Webhooks

Nhận thông báo delivery status real-time qua webhook chuẩn

📦

Multi-language SDKs

Node.js, PHP, Python, Go, Ruby, Java, C#, JavaScript, React

🧪

Sandbox Environment

Test miễn phí không giới hạn trước khi deploy production

Minh bạch đến từng đồng xu

Theo dõi và phân tích toàn bộ quá trình gửi tin nhắn với observability đầy đủ

📊

Real-time Message Tracking

Theo dõi trạng thái tin nhắn theo thời gian thực. Mỗi message có trace_id riêng để debug và audit.

💰

Automatic Cost Reconciliation

Đối soát chi phí tự động theo từng kênh. Báo cáo chi tiết về chi phí thực tế và dự đoán chi phí.

📈

Channel Conversion Reports

Báo cáo tỷ lệ chuyển đổi và hiệu quả của từng kênh. Tối ưu routing strategy dựa trên dữ liệu thực tế.

Bắt đầu tích hợp ngay - Tài liệu API chỉ 1 trang

Tích hợp Notiboost trong 5 phút. Không cần thẻ tín dụng, test miễn phí không giới hạn.

Không cần thẻ tín dụng Setup trong 5 phút API-first Architecture